The ARIZONA KIT CAR
CLUB, Inc. is a
non-profit corporation. There is no limit or
restriction, based on age, sex, national origin, race, color,
or religious preferences, for membership or for holding any
office in the Club. To operate a kit car, each member must
possess a valid drivers license and insurance coverage
for the vehicle.
It was founded and incorporated in 1987 by a
group of replica car enthusiasts. The club is one of the
largest organizations of hand crafted automobiles in the
country. Many have built their own cars while others have
purchased a ready-made vehicle.
The aims and objectives of the AKCC include the following:
- Promotion of, interest in, and the enjoyment of
the hobby of construction and/or operation of vehicles
classified as kit cars.
- Promotion of activities for the owners of kit
cars, such as rallies, road trips, parades, car shows, outings
and social functions.
- Assistance to others in the advancement of the
hobby through exchange of information.
- Promotion of safety in the construction and
operation of kit cars.

Monthly meetings are held from September through
May at various locations throughout the Phoenix metropolitan
area. Meeting dates vary. Check the Web site's
"Calendar" page for the date, time, and
location.
The owners of the kit cars and members
of AKCC are extremely
proud of their vehicles and are always pleased with the
opportunity to display them.
